While the world is now beginning to show signs of opening up, when I joined 7 Communications it was during wave #2. With no end in sight to the stay-at-home orders, I joined my new team remotely. To this day, I have yet to meet my company teammates in person. Honestly not the way I ever would have imagined a new role, but it’s been great.After a rigorous but amazing interview process I was welcomed with holiday gifts last Christmas and stoked to join such a kind, talented and dynamic team. Although I initially had concerns about how remote working would impact my ability to hit the ground running at a new job, the 7 Communications team was super supportive and provided the right equipment and platforms to get the job done.My first week was productive, informative, and engaging. My teammates helped make the onboarding process proceed smoothly while I integrated and acclimatized to the virtual work environment and the company itself. I had virtual coffee chats with a few colleagues from other departments and it was nice to talk to them and find out what they were working on. It was all very surreal, and I quickly felt like a valued member of the team despite having met almost none of them in person. After going through training for the first few weeks, I  had a great feel for the company culture and processes.The introduction of the Slack platform greatly helped with collaboration, gaining insights from all levels of the company, sharing files and engaging with teammates. It’s hard to imagine working without it now! A real downside to working remotely is the lack of physical interaction — the office energy and banter that you can't replace from home. I have also come to accept that one’s personality or intent cannot always be conveyed in the same way over purely audio or video interactions. I do count myself fortunate that although I haven’t met most of my co-workers in person, I always feel valued and part of a greater whole.I expectantly await a time where we all can attend events, collaborate physically and have more meaningful face-to-face interactions but before that, remote working as a part of the 7 Communications Team has been a very rewarding and valuable experience.
